AI-powered background removal using rembg + ONNX Runtime with GPU acceleration. Cross-platform: Linux, Windows, macOS.
- GIMP 3.2+
- Python 3.10+ with
python3-venv - GPU (optional): see Hardware / Provider Mapping below

| Hardware | Package Installed | Execution Provider |
|---|---|---|
| NVIDIA Linux | onnxruntime-gpu |
CUDAExecutionProvider |
| NVIDIA Windows | onnxruntime-directml |
DmlExecutionProvider |
| AMD Windows | onnxruntime-directml |
DmlExecutionProvider |
| AMD Linux | onnxruntime (CPU) |
CPUExecutionProvider |
| Intel Arc/iGPU Windows | onnxruntime-directml |
DmlExecutionProvider |
| Intel iGPU Linux | onnxruntime (CPU) |
CPUExecutionProvider |
| Apple Silicon | onnxruntime-silicon |
CoreMLExecutionProvider |
| CPU-only | onnxruntime (CPU) |
CPUExecutionProvider |
Windows NVIDIA note: install.sh defaults to DirectML (zero-config) instead of CUDA to avoid requiring a separate CUDA Toolkit installation. Falling back to CPU is always automatic.
install.sh detects your GPU and installs the correct ONNX Runtime package automatically.

# 1. Install system dependencies (if missing)
# Debian/Ubuntu:
sudo apt install python3 python3-venv
# macOS:
brew install python3
# 2. Create shared venv
python3 -m venv ~/.gimp-plugin-shared-venv/venv
# 3. Install packages (pick ONE onnxruntime package for your GPU)
source ~/.gimp-plugin-shared-venv/venv/bin/activate
pip install --upgrade pip
# NVIDIA GPU:
pip install onnxruntime-gpu rembg[gpu] pillow "numpy>=2.0,<2.5"
# Apple Silicon:
pip install onnxruntime-silicon rembg pillow "numpy>=2.0,<2.5"
# CPU / AMD Linux / Intel Linux:
pip install onnxruntime rembg pillow "numpy>=2.0,<2.5"
deactivate
# 4. Copy plugin files
PLUGINS=~/.config/GIMP/3.2/plug-ins/remove-background
mkdir -p "$PLUGINS"
cp remove-background.py run_worker.sh bg_remove_worker.py "$PLUGINS/"
chmod +x "$PLUGINS/remove-background.py"
chmod +x "$PLUGINS/run_worker.sh"
# 5. Flatpak only — grant host access
flatpak override --user --talk-name=org.freedesktop.Flatpak org.gimp.GIMP
# 6. Restart GIMP → Filters → Enhance → Remove BackgroundRun all commands in Git Bash:

# 5. Restart GIMP → Filters → Enhance → Remove Background- Open an image in GIMP
- Select a layer
- Filters > Enhance > Remove Background
- New layer
[name] (bg removed)appears with transparent background
First run downloads the AI model (~176 MB). Subsequent runs use the cached model.
Layer → Export PNG → rembg (onnxruntime-gpu + CUDA) → Cutout PNG → New layer
On Flatpak GIMP, flatpak-spawn --host escapes the sandbox to reach the host GPU.
Plugin not in menu: chmod +x ~/.config/GIMP/3.2/plug-ins/remove-background/*.py
ModuleNotFoundError: onnxruntime: re-run install.sh
CUDA not detected: verify nvidia-smi, re-run install.sh
